School age population, primary education, both sexes in World
World: School age population, primary education, both sexes was 727.84 million number in 2019. β² Rising
School age population, primary education, both sexes in World, 1970β2019
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in number.
Analysis
In 2019, school age population, primary education, both sexes in World stood at 727.84 million number. That is the highest value across all 50 years on record.
The figure is up 0.9% on the previous year and up 8.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, school age population, primary education, both sexes in World peaked at 727.84 million number in 2019 and was at its lowest, 451.31 million number, in 1970.
That places World 1st out of 44 groups with data for 2019, putting it in the top 10%.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 50 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 496.97 million number | 451.31 million number | 538.09 million number | 10 |
| 1980s | 557.47 million number | 544.17 million number | 571.20 million number | 10 |
| 1990s | 627.20 million number | 578.16 million number | 667.56 million number | 10 |
| 2000s | 662.51 million number | 645.87 million number | 672.57 million number | 10 |
| 2010s | 699.70 million number | 675.70 million number | 727.84 million number | 10 |

About this data
Population of the age-group theoretically corresponding to primary education as indicated by theoretical entrance age and duration.
